首页游戏攻略文章正文

如何利用CMD实现高效远程连接并确保安全性

游戏攻略2025年07月16日 13:26:068admin

如何利用CMD实现高效远程连接并确保安全性通过Windows内置的CMD工具实现远程连接主要依赖telnet或SSH协议,但telnet因明文传输存在安全隐患,建议优先选择SSH配合OpenSSH服务。我们这篇文章将从准备条件、操作步骤到

cmd远程连接

如何利用CMD实现高效远程连接并确保安全性

通过Windows内置的CMD工具实现远程连接主要依赖telnet或SSH协议,但telnet因明文传输存在安全隐患,建议优先选择SSH配合OpenSSH服务。我们这篇文章将从准备条件、操作步骤到加密优化进行系统说明,并强调2025年环境下必须注意的网络安全要点。

CMD远程连接的两种核心方式

传统telnet方案虽然配置简单(通过telnet [IP] [端口]即可连接),但其数据包未经加密的特性已无法满足当前网络安全标准。微软自Windows 10 1809版本起内置的OpenSSH客户端成为更优选择,配合服务端的SSH守护进程可建立加密隧道。

现代OpenSSH连接方案

在管理员权限的CMD中执行ssh username@hostname -p 22建立连接前,需确认目标主机已启用SSH服务。2025年推荐使用Ed25519密钥替代传统的RSA算法,生成命令为ssh-keygen -t ed25519

实现连接的关键前置步骤

防火墙配置往往是被忽视的环节,需放行相应端口(SSH默认22/tcp)。企业环境中还需注意组策略限制,通过gpedit.msc调整"网络访问:可远程访问的注册表路径"等设置。跨网络连接时,建议搭配VPN或零信任网络架构。

安全强化措施与替代方案

基础连接建立后,应禁用密码认证并启用双因素验证。对于需要持续会话的场景,可配合screentmux工具。若需图形界面支持,可通过SSH隧道转发RDP端口(ssh -L 3389:localhost:3389 user@host)。

Q&A常见问题

连接出现"Connection refused"如何排查

在一开始验证目标服务是否监听(netstat -ano | findstr :22),然后接下来检查防火墙规则和路由可达性。企业网络可能需额外处理NAT转换或代理设置。

如何在不安装第三方软件的情况下传输文件

OpenSSH内置SCP功能可通过scp ./file.txt user@host:/path实现加密传输,较FTP等传统方式更安全且无需额外配置。

CMD与PowerShell在远程管理中的优劣对比

PowerShell Remoting基于WS-Management协议,支持对象级数据传输和更细粒度的会话控制,但需要预先配置WinRM服务。常规快速操作仍推荐CMD+SSH组合。

标签: 远程连接技术网络安全实践Windows系统管理加密通信协议运维自动化

游戏圈Copyright @ 2013-2023 All Rights Reserved. 版权所有备案号:京ICP备2024049502号-8